    def extract(self, path):
        file = open(join(self.documents, path), 'rb')
        filename = file.name.split('/')[-1]
        text, images, page_count = FileDocument(file, filename).extract()
        path = join(self.path, filename)

        extracted = get_or_write_file(path + '.txt', text)

        self.assertEqual(text, extracted.read())
        self.assertEqual(page_count, self.pages[filename.split('.')[-1]])

    def test_extraction(self):
        # Check if extraction works succesfully
        result = extract_from_file(self.file_preview.id)
        self.assertTrue(result)

        # Check if the extraction did occur
        self.file_preview = FilePreview.objects.get(id=self.file_preview.id)
        self.assertTrue(self.file_preview.extracted)

        # This is similar to test_file_document
        path = join(self.path, DOCX_FILE)
        extracted = get_or_write_file(path + '.txt', self.file_preview.text)
        self.assertEqual(
            ' '.join(self.file_preview.text.split()),
            ' '.join(extracted.read().split()),
        )
